What stands out at Km Connect

Km Connect is a small charter combined-grade school in Wales, Wisconsin, enrolling 35 students.

Class loads run heavy: 35:1 is larger than about 98% of Wisconsin schools and 143% above the 14.4:1 state mean, so each teacher carries more students than is typical.

Its free-meal eligibility rate of 30.8% lands close to the Wisconsin typical range, neither a high- nor low-need campus by this measure.

This is a small campus: fewer students than 95% of Wisconsin schools, with 35 enrolled.

Its Resource Investment Index trails 100% of the 2,202 Wisconsin schools with a score on record, one of the lower results on this measure.

Among 35 similarly sized, similarly resourced-need Wisconsin schools statewide, it ranks #35, in the lower tier once campus size and economic need are matched.

Its student body is led by White (77%) and Hispanic or Latino (9%) (diversity index 39/100).

Among Wales's public schools, it stands alongside Wales Elementary (333 students): Km Connect is smaller than that campus by headcount and runs heavier classes (35:1 vs 14.5:1).

Kettle Moraine School District also operates Kettle Moraine High (869 students) and Kettle Moraine Middle (726 students) alongside Km Connect.
